JPMorgan Chase & Co. Has $3.10 Million Stake in Mativ Holdings, Inc. (NYSE:MATV)

Mativ logo with Basic Materials background

JPMorgan Chase & Co. lifted its stake in Mativ Holdings, Inc. (NYSE:MATV - Free Report) by 44.5% in the fourth quarter, according to the company in its most recent fil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ission. The institutional investor owned 284,348 shares of the company's stock after buying an additional 87,526 shares during the period. JPMorgan Chase & Co. owned about 0.52% of Mativ worth $3,099,000 at the end of the most recent reporting period.

Several other hedge funds and other institutional investors have also modified their holdings of MATV. Peregrine Capital Management LLC bought a new position in shares of Mativ during the fourth quarter valued at $4,397,000. American Century Companies Inc. increased its position in shares of Mativ by 20.2% during the 4th quarter. American Century Companies Inc. now owns 1,507,418 shares of the company's stock worth $16,431,000 after purchasing an additional 253,365 shares in the last quarter. Royce & Associates LP lifted its holdings in Mativ by 26.1% during the 4th quarter. Royce & Associates LP now owns 1,090,774 shares of the company's stock valued at $11,889,000 after purchasing an additional 226,090 shares during the last quarter. Bank of New York Mellon Corp boosted its position in Mativ by 44.2% in the fourth quarter. Bank of New York Mellon Corp now owns 613,444 shares of the company's stock valued at $6,687,000 after buying an additional 187,970 shares in the last quarter. Finally, Sei Investments Co. grew its stake in Mativ by 174.2% during the fourth quarter. Sei Investments Co. now owns 286,992 shares of the company's stock worth $3,128,000 after buying an additional 182,341 shares during the last quarter. Institutional investors own 94.95% of the company's stock.

Mativ Company Profile

(Free Report)

Mativ Holdings, Inc, together with its subsidiaries, manufactures and sells specialty materials in the United States, Europe, the Asia Pacific, the Americas, and internationally. The company operates through two segments, Advanced Technical Materials and Fiber-Based Solutions. The Advanced Technical Materials manufactures and sells various engineered polymer, resin and fiber-based substrates, nets, films, adhesive tapes, and other nonwovens for the filtration, protective solutions, release liners, and healthcare end-markets.
